The foster father of Jesus and protector of the Holy Family, St. Joseph was a humble carpenter whose silent faith shaped the Savior's home. Patron of fathers, workers, and the universal Church, he embodied faithful labor offered to God.

OLGM Benedictine Monks

Every batch of Sanctus Coffee is hand-roasted by the Benedictine monks of OLGM, following the ancient rhythm of Ora et Labora — prayer and work. Roasting is more than craft; it is work carried out with discipline, intention, and devotion.
